1. What would the polynomial x + 7 – 4x^3 be written as in standard form?

The only thing we need to do to get this polynomial in standard form is rearrange the terms!

x+7-4x^3
-4x^3+x+7 is the polynomial written in standard form. Remember to keep track of the negatives!

The GCF of the polynomial
24x^5+18x^9 is...
6x^5
Because it is the greatest term that goes into both 24x^5 AND 18x^9!
This will end up helping you factor later on.
6x^5(4+3x^4)

8. A substance has a half life of 2.347 minutes.
mina [271]

Answer:

a.) 4 half lives have passed

b) 9.388 minutes

Step-by-step explanation:

Formula for exponential growth / decay is given as:

A=A_0b^{\frac{t}{c}}

Where A is the final population

A_0 is the initial population

b is the growth factor

c is the time taken for the growth 'b'

t is the amount of time

Here, we are given that:

A = 6. 9 grams

A_0 = 110.4 grams

b = \dfrac{1}{2}

c = 2.347 min

To find:

a.) Number of half lives taken for the decay.

b.) Total time in the decay.

Solution:

a.) Number of half lives taken for the decay is nothing but equal to \frac{t}{c}.

Putting the values in the formula, we get:

6.9=110.4\times \frac{1}2^{\frac{t}{c}}\\\Rightarrow 6.9=110.4\times 0.5^{\frac{t}{c}}\\\Rightarrow 0.0625=0.5^{\frac{t}{c}}\\\Rightarrow \dfrac{t}{c} =4

Therefore, the answer is:

<em>4 half lives </em>have passed.

b.) Total time of decay. We have to find the value of t here.

From answer of part a.):

\dfrac{t}{c} =4\\\Rightarrow \dfrac{t}{2.347} =4\\\Rightarrow t =\bold{9.388\ min}
